Turns over fast will fire on easy start but will not run
alot of air bubbles coming through diesel lines.
Reply
#46
ie. Delivery pressure, Most likely air in pump, try turning engine over while squeezing priming bulb.
Check the 3 items related to this for loose wires etc.

1277 - HP deactivation valve.
1322 - HP regulator.
1321 - HP sensor.
